Now, with regards to the 2.0 API, I have created a wiki page, that points to the 1.0 -> 2.0 diff (bottom link). It can be accessed at: https://github.com/libusbx/libusbx/wiki/API-2.0 Basically, I have created a libusb.h wiki page [1], containing the header, and I'm just using the history diff from the wiki for link. You can edit the header, preferably adding your changes in the list from the API-2.0 page as well, and once you're done, just go to page history, select the first and latest, and click compare revisions. You should then update the link from the API-2.0 page with the URL you get. I wish there was a way to get a diff that displays the full content of the page, but haven't been able to get that from github. Note that at this stage, not all the changes we discussed are in, so feel free to go ahead and add the missing ones.
